VM hosting technology enables the creation of multiple isolated environments known as virtual machines. It’s possible to test new upgrades within these, roll back the system to a previous version or develop without worrying about software licenses.

Hosting multiple varieties of server environments can be a bit complicated. Also, when specific servers need to be added or removed, the process can take much time and effort. The virtual machine eliminates this patchwork setup and allows servers to be deployed at the click of a button. It saves money and resources because it provides a complete environment for any application instead of just one type of application.

  • Data Migration 

Migrating to the cloud requires a great deal of planning and time. Traditional data migration mechanisms are complex, time-consuming and inefficient. Data migration in the cloud is possible with an innovative technology known as Storage Virtualization. 

Storage virtualization is a technique of efficiently managing storage resources to deliver the most optimum performance at the lowest cost. Migration to the cloud is easy with virtual machines because it makes it possible to monitor your data storage repository in the cloud remotely.
